Show/Hide Menu
Hide/Show Apps
Logout
Türkçe
Türkçe
Search
Search
Login
Login
OpenMETU
OpenMETU
About
About
Open Science Policy
Open Science Policy
Open Access Guideline
Open Access Guideline
Postgraduate Thesis Guideline
Postgraduate Thesis Guideline
Communities & Collections
Communities & Collections
Help
Help
Frequently Asked Questions
Frequently Asked Questions
Guides
Guides
Thesis submission
Thesis submission
MS without thesis term project submission
MS without thesis term project submission
Publication submission with DOI
Publication submission with DOI
Publication submission
Publication submission
Supporting Information
Supporting Information
General Information
General Information
Copyright, Embargo and License
Copyright, Embargo and License
Contact us
Contact us
Variability modeling in component oriented software engineering
Date
2014-06-19
Author
Kaya, Muhammed Çağrı
Doğru, Ali Hikmet
Metadata
Show full item record
Item Usage Stats
142
views
0
downloads
Cite This
A new meta-model is proposed that establishes a variability specification and system configuration environment for Component Oriented System Engineering Modeling Language (COSEML). Variability is integrated to COSEML that can be viewed as an Architectural Description Language emphasizing the decomposition view. The textual version of this language is also presented and demonstrated with an example specification
URI
https://sdpsnet.org/sdps/documents/sdps-2014/SDPS2014_END_V2.pdf
https://hdl.handle.net/11511/75658
Conference Name
SDPS the 19th International Conference on Transformative Science and Engineering, Business and Social Innovation.5 - 19 Haziran 2014
Collections
Department of Computer Engineering, Conference / Seminar
Suggestions
OpenMETU
Core
Scalable computational steering for visualization/control of large-scale fluid dynamics simulations
Modi, Anirudh; Sezer Uzol, Nilay; Long, Lyle N.; Plassmann, Paul E. (2005-01-01)
The development, integration, and testing of a general-purpose "computational steering" software library with a three-dimensional Navier-Stokes flow solver is described. For this purpose, the portable object-oriented scientific steering environment (called POSSE) library was used. This library can be coupled to any C/C++ simulation code. The paper illustrates how to integrate computational steering into a code, how to monitor the solution while it is being computed, and how to adjust the parameters of the a...
Component Oriented design based on Axiomatic Design Theory and COSEML
toğay, Cengiz; Doğru, Ali Hikmet (2006-11-03)
A Component Oriented software development method is proposed that uses collaboration diagrams for the definitions of dependencies among the Functional Requirements and Design Parameters according to Axiomatic Design Theory. COSEML is a component oriented graphical modeling language utilizing a single hierarchy diagram to construct systems. Axiomatic design theory provides a systematic approach to application design where developers can see all the determined dependencies among functional requirements and so...
Variable connectors in component oriented development
Çetinkaya, Anıl; Doğru, Ali Hikmet; Department of Computer Engineering (2017)
Variability is incorporated in component oriented software development especially in the connectors besides components, for efficient configuration of software products in this thesis. Components have been regarded as the main building blocks in the development of software, especially in component based approaches. Connectors, however, were also part of the solution but with not much of a responsibility when compared to components. When considered in a holistic approach to yield executable code starting wit...
Variability modeling in software product lines
Kaşıkçı, Barış Can Cengiz; Bilgen, Semih; Department of Electrical and Electronics Engineering (2009)
Software product lines provide enhanced means for systematic reuse when constructing systems within a particular domain. In order to achieve this, systems in a product line are expected to have a significant amount of commonality. Variability is what distinguishes these systems from one another and is spread across various product line artifacts. This thesis focuses on modeling and managing product line variability. The concept of concerns is proposed as a means of variability modeling. Another proposal is ...
Numerical calculation of backfilling of scour holes
Sumer, B Mutlu; Baykal, Cüneyt; Fuhrman, David R; Jacobsen, Niels G; Fredsoe, Jorgen (2014-12-04)
A fully-coupled hydrodynamic and morphologic CFD model is presented for simulating backfilling processes around structures. The hydrodynamic model is based on Reynolds-averaged Navier-Stokes equations, coupled with two-equation k-ω turbulence closure. The sediment transport model consists of separate bed and suspended load descriptions, the latter based on a turbulent diffusion equation coupled with a reference concentration function near the sea bed boundary. Bed morphology is based on the sediment continu...
Citation Formats
IEEE
ACM
APA
CHICAGO
MLA
BibTeX
M. Ç. Kaya and A. H. Doğru, “Variability modeling in component oriented software engineering,” presented at the SDPS the 19th International Conference on Transformative Science and Engineering, Business and Social Innovation.5 - 19 Haziran 2014, Kuching Sarawak, Malaysia, 2014, Accessed: 00, 2021. [Online]. Available: https://sdpsnet.org/sdps/documents/sdps-2014/SDPS2014_END_V2.pdf.